The Utah Jazz (6-6) will have their hands full against the league’s top scoring defense when they meet the Memphis Grizzlies (7-4) at FedExForum. Action starts at 8 p.m. ET on Monday, November 12, 2018.

Both teams defeated their last opponent. The Grizzlies defeated the Philadelphia 76ers 112-106, while the Jazz beat the Boston Celtics 123-115.

Utah played a nearly perfect game. They had an offensive rebounding percentage of 25.8 (above their season average of 22.8) and a free throw rate of 0.312 (above their season average of 0.253). For those same stats, Boston was 11.9 and 0.227, respectively. The Grizzlies, on the other hand, forced 23 turnovers and had an offensive rebounding percentage of 27.3 (above their season average of 17.5). Memphis’ Mike Conley had a good game, putting up 32 points and six assists. Rudy Gobert, meanwhile was a key piece for Utah with 17 points and 15 rebounds.

The Grizzlies have won both contests against the Jazz this year. Memphis won 110-100. Getting to the charity stripe was one of Memphis’ biggest strengths. They had 34 free throw attempts, while Utah had 25. Marc Gasol put up a double-double in the victory with 17 points and 10 rebounds.

Derrick Favors has been excellent over the last five games for Utah, averaging 12.4 points, 7.2 rebounds and 1.6 blocks per game.

Half-court execution will be at a premium when two of the NBA’s slowest-paced teams face off. Memphis currently ranks 30th in possessions per game (98.0) and Utah is 22nd (101.5). Also, the elite offense of the Jazz ranks fourth in effective field goal percentage (0.539), while the Grizzlies are eighth-worst in the NBA at effective field goal percentage allowed (0.533).
